Just Had Rhinoplasty and Am in Excruciating Pain Despite Painkillers. Is This Normal? (photo)

I had rhinoplasty yesterday and I know it's soon to ask but I am in excruciating pain even with painkillers and made it almost impossible to sleep yesterday. Is this normal or should I get different medication or talk to my doctor, etc... And FYI I had my nose narrowed, tipped it up and the bone was lowered. And am also 18 years old and I don't know if this is also crucial to know for the pain.

Intense pain after rhinoplasty

This is very uncommon. You should be seen immediately to make sure that you don't have a septal hematoma, or compromised blood flow to the skin among other potential causes.
